1
如何使用DataGridView數據(VB/C#.NET)填充Datatable?使用DataGridView數據在VB/C#.NET中填充數據表格
如何使用DataGridView數據(VB/C#.NET)填充Datatable?使用DataGridView數據在VB/C#.NET中填充數據表格
假設它是一個WinForm
下面的代碼可以幫助
//dgv is the name of your data grid view.
DataTable dt = new DataTable();
DataColumn[] dcs = new DataColumn[]{};
foreach (DataGridViewColumn c in dgv.Columns)
{
DataColumn dc = new DataColumn();
dc.ColumnName = c.Name;
dc.DataType = c.ValueType;
dt.Columns.Add(dc);
}
foreach (DataGridViewRow r in dgv.Rows)
{
DataRow drow = dt.NewRow();
foreach (DataGridViewCell cell in r.Cells)
{
drow[cell.OwningColumn.Name] = cell.Value;
}
dt.Rows.Add(drow);
}
你能否詳細說明你的問題有點。你的datagridview是否綁定了另一個數據表? datagridview中的數據如何填充?等等 – JPReddy 2010-12-02 05:16:52